Why Timber Frame Construction Is Booming in 2026

The UK construction industry is undergoing a major shift. Timber frame is now considered a mainstream method of construction, supported by developers, architects, and government-backed sustainability initiatives.

Key reasons behind the rise:

  • Increased demand for low-carbon construction
  • Faster project delivery using off-site timber frame systems
  • Improved energy efficiency for modern homes
  • Strong growth in self-build timber frame homes

In fact, timber frame construction is predicted to account for a significant share of new UK homes by 2030, reflecting its growing popularity as estimated by Timber Development UK.

Top Timber Frame Trends in the UK Right Now

1. Sustainable Timber Frame Construction Sustainability is one of the biggest drivers behind timber frame growth.
  • Timber is a renewable, low-carbon building material
  • It stores carbon throughout its lifecycle
  • It significantly reduces embodied carbon compared to steel and concrete

2. Off-Site & Prefabricated Timber Frame Systems

Modern timber frame homes are increasingly built using off-site manufacturing.

Benefits include:

  • Up to 50% faster build times
  • Reduced waste and site disruption
  • Greater accuracy and quality control

This is why prefabricated timber frame houses and flat-pack home kits are becoming a popular choice for developers and self-builders alike.

3. Engineered Timber (CLT, Glulam & LVL)

Engineered timber is transforming what’s possible in modern construction.

  • Allows larger open-plan designs
  • Offers excellent strength-to-weight ratio
  • Suitable for residential and commercial builds

Benefits of Choosing Timber Frame Construction

A modern timber frame home delivers long-term value across multiple areas:

Speed of Build
Timber frame structures can be erected in a matter of weeks, dramatically reducing project timelines.

Energy Efficiency
Excellent insulation and airtightness lead to lower energy bills and improved comfort.

Design Flexibility
Open-plan layouts, extensions, and bespoke designs are easily achievable.

Sustainability
Timber frame aligns with the UK’s net-zero targets and future building regulations.

Cost Certainty
Off-site manufacturing helps minimise delays and unexpected costs.
